The Rise of Plastic Frame Materials A Look at Leading Companies in the Industry


In recent years, the demand for plastic frame materials has surged, driven by advancements in technology and evolving consumer preferences. Plastic frames are now widely used in various sectors, including eyewear, automotive, construction, and furniture. This article explores the significance of plastic frame materials and highlights some leading companies in the industry.


Plastic frame materials offer several advantages over traditional materials such as wood and metal. They are lightweight, resistant to corrosion, and often more cost-effective. Additionally, plastic frames can be easily molded into complex shapes, allowing for innovative designs that cater to diverse consumer needs. As the world continues to prioritize sustainability, many manufacturers are now producing biodegradable and recycled plastic materials, further enhancing the appeal of plastic frames.

Another significant player in the plastic frame market is Luxottica, headquartered in Italy. Luxottica is a powerhouse in the eyewear industry and owns multiple retail brands, including Ray-Ban and Oakley. The company invests heavily in research and development to create high-quality plastic frames that blend style with functionality. Luxottica's commitment to sustainability is evident in its initiatives to reduce carbon emissions and implement environmentally friendly practices across its operations.

In the automotive sector, Continental AG has made a name for itself with its advanced plastic frame materials used in various vehicle applications. As a leading supplier, Continental develops lightweight, high-strength plastic components that enhance vehicle performance and fuel efficiency. The company's commitment to innovation has led to the creation of materials that not only meet automotive standards but also contribute to sustainability by reducing the overall weight of vehicles.


BASF SE, one of the world's largest chemical producers, has also made significant strides in the plastic frame materials market. The company's innovative plastics, such as Ultradur® and Styrolution™, are widely used in automotive, consumer goods, and electronic applications. BASF prioritizes sustainability and has developed solutions that reduce environmental impact while maintaining superior quality and performance.


Solvay Group, a global leader in advanced materials and specialty chemicals, has been actively involved in developing high-performance plastic frames. With a strong commitment to sustainability, Solvay focuses on creating materials that are not only efficient but also environmentally friendly. Their products find applications in various industries, including aerospace, automotive, and healthcare, showcasing the versatility of plastic frame materials.


As the industry continues to evolve, emerging companies like Mawooz are stepping into the spotlight. This innovative startup focuses on creating customizable plastic frames for eyewear, allowing consumers to express their unique style while enjoying the benefits of lightweight and durable materials. By leveraging cutting-edge technology and sustainable practices, Mawooz is capturing the interest of environmentally conscious consumers.
